Andalusia is the smallest of the four areas for Dermatology Specialists of Alabama along with Dothan, Enterprise, and Troy. Services offered include skin cancer diagnosis and screening, skin cancer removal, biopsies and cryosurgery for chronic skin disorders such as warts, rashes acne, warts, and treatment for eczema, Mohs operation, mole assessment as well as treatment and testing of skin allergic conditions, as well as advanced treatments for various issues affecting the hair, skin, and nails.
Dermatology Specialists of Alabama is managed and run through Southeastern Dermatology Group, PA along with Dermatology Solutions Group, LLC which has more than 20 practices for medical care in the south-central United States.
